Someone correct me if I'm wrong, but heat pumps and reverse cycle a/c are the same thing, right? And that should mean a variable capacity heat pump is the same as inverter reverse cycle a/c. If so, we just had a 14kW reverse cycle ducted Panasonic inverter system installed a couple months ago, and it's awesome. Will do from 3.3 - 15.5kW of cooling, and 4.1 - 18kw of heating, max actual power draw of around 5.5kW or so. Has no problem keeping our poorly insulated 1980s house cool here in Perth even in temps above 40C, and the power draw when it's idling at night is only around 600W or so. I could see the temp range of -20C to 46C being a problem in places like the midwestern US, but it's perfect here where temps never drop below 0C. It's great combined with the 5kW of solar I had installed at the same time, on all but the hottest days the power draw of the A/C is lower than the generation of my solar panels (thanks to the inverter that doesn't need to cycle on and off), so it often costs me nothing to run. Compared to what my power costs would be without solar, the panels will pay for themselves in about 3-4 years.
